To find points to plot do the same thing you do for equalities.
Let x=0 and solve for y:
y=9(0)+4
y=0+4
y=4 Plot (0,4)
Let x=-1 and solve for y:
y=9(-1)+4
y=-9+4
y=-5 Plot (-1,5)
Because this is a less than OR EQUAL to, connect the points with a solid line. Because y is by itself on one side of the inequality sign and y is LESS than the other side, shade below the line.
Some teachers like to have you use a test point like (0,0) in the original equation. If the statement is true, shade towards the test point. True, shade towards the origin.
I can't show you the shading, but I can show you what the line looks like:
